    1. The number of devices that can be connected to a single IoT Hub resource in Azure varies based on the pricing tier:
    • Free tier: Up to 500 devices
    • Basic tier: Varies based on units, can go up to millions of devices
    • Standard tier: Varies based on units, can go up to millions of devices
    1. The cost for connecting 250 devices for a year would depend on the tier of IoT Hub. Please refer to this table
    2. For Azure IoT Central, the number of sensors that can be connected to a single device is not strictly limited by the platform itself but rather by the capabilities of the device IoT Central supports 1,000,000 devices per application.
